One of the key distinguishing factors of EPS 100 Lambda is its impressive thermal conductivity rating With a thermal conductivity of 0.033 W/mK, EPS 100 Lambda offers superior insulation properties compared to traditional forms of polystyrene foam This low thermal conductivity means that EPS 100 Lambda can effectively reduce heat transfer through walls, floors, and roofs, helping to maintain a comfortable indoor temperature and reduce the need for heating and cooling systems In addition to lowering energy costs for building owners, this enhanced thermal performance also contributes to a smaller carbon footprint by reducing greenhouse gas emissions associated with heating and cooling.
Another standout feature of EPS 100 Lambda is its exceptional compressive strength With compressive strength values ranging from 100 kPa to 700 kPa, depending on the density of the foam, EPS 100 Lambda can support heavy loads without losing its shape or structural integrity This makes it an ideal choice for insulating foundations, floors, and other structural elements that require robust support and durability By choosing EPS 100 Lambda for these critical applications, builders can ensure that their structures remain stable and secure over time, even in challenging environmental conditions.
